Questions about Raddish

  • What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?

    Raddish, being a Pit Bull Terrier, typically does well in an active living environment where she can receive lots of attention and exercise.

  • How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?

    Pit Bull Terriers like Raddish enjoy having ample outdoor space to play and burn off energy, so a yard or access to a park would be ideal.

  •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?

    This breed can be very good with children when properly introduced and socialized, making Raddish a potential fit for family homes.
